Transaction

ec61393dcbbb2b2de3eb0a13304e891b4e36eee389bcd2c4accb3283c3f56562
59,689 confirmations
Timestamp
1734450658
Block875,169
Fee1,800 sats
Fee rate8.07 sats/vB
view on mempool.space

Inputs & Outputs